新媒体网络编程是什么意思

新媒体网络编程是什么意思

新媒体网络编程通常指的是1、利用程序化方法创作、发布和管理内容,2、借助自动化工具配合内容推广以及3、采用数据分析来优化网络内容传播策略。这个概念融合了传统的内容创作和现代技术的优势,特别是在搜索引擎优化(SEO)领域中,它帮助发布的内容更符合搜索引擎算法,从而在搜索结果中排名更高,吸引更多访问者。

利用程序化方法创作内容,意味着新媒体工作者可以使用各种编程工具和脚本来自动生成或者改善文章、图片和视频等内容。这种方法可以极大地提高工作效率和内容的多样性。例如,某新闻网站可能会开发一个程序来自动收集各地的天气信息并生成相关新闻报导,这使得内容创作变得更加迅速和精准。

一、新媒体网络编程的核心概念

新媒体网络编程融入了多种技术手段,涉及内容创作自动化数据驱动的内容优化交互性增强等方面。其核心在于通过技术手段提升内容的质量和传播效率,以满足日益个性化和多样化的用户需求。

二、程序化内容创作

程序化内容创作是新媒体网络编程中的关键环节。这涉及使用自动化工具和算法来快速生成新闻、社交媒体帖子等内容。例如,自然语言生成技术(NLG)可以从数据中自动产生文本描述,而模板驱动的内容生成可以快速填充特定格式的信息,提高内容的制作效率。

三、搜索引擎优化

搜索引擎优化(SEO)在新媒体网络编程中扮演至关重要的角色。它涉及定制内容和网站结构,使之更加适配搜索引擎的排名算法。关键词研究网站架构优化是实现高效SEO的基石,而持续的性能监控和内容更新能保证网站的长期排名效果。

四、内容推广与数据分析

内容的推广在新媒体网络编程中同样重要。通过使用社交媒体自动化工具、邮件营销系统和在线广告平台,新媒体网络编程可以实现更高效的内容分发和目标用户的精准触达。与此同时,数据分析则能够衡量推广活动的效果,并及时调整策略以优化ROI。

五、用户体验和互动性

提升用户体验和增加内容的互动性是新媒体网络编程不能忽视的部分。通过编程和技术集成,如引入聊天机器人、互动问卷调查等,新媒体平台可以为用户提供更加个性化和沉浸式的内容体验。

六、新媒体网络编程的挑战与机遇

随着技术的发展,新媒体网络编程面临着内容质量、知识产权、算法透明度等多方面的挑战。同时,它也带来了机遇,创新技术的整合应用正在不断地定义和拓展新媒体内容的边界。

总结而言,新媒体网络编程是一个综合性的领域,它结合了内容创作、技术应用和数据分析,致力于在数字时代提高内容的影响力和价值。随着技术的不断进步,新媒体网络编程将继续推动媒体行业的创新和变革。

相关问答FAQs:

新媒体网络编程是指使用计算机和互联网技术,将信息内容通过网络平台进行传播和交流的过程。它涵盖了使用编程语言和工具进行网页开发、移动应用开发、社交媒体运营等一系列技术和操作。

1. 新媒体网络编程的作用是什么?
新媒体网络编程的作用主要有两个方面:
首先,它使得信息传播更加便捷和快速。通过网络平台,人们可以随时随地获取和分享信息,实现信息的跨地域和跨时间的传递。这大大提高了信息的传播效率,使得信息更容易被广大用户获取到。
其次,新媒体网络编程也为交流和互动提供了更多的可能性。通过网络平台,用户可以进行评论、留言、点赞等互动行为,以及参与在线讨论和活动。这使得用户不再是信息的被动接收者,而是能够直接参与到信息的创作和传播中。

2. 新媒体网络编程的技术有哪些?
新媒体网络编程涉及的技术非常丰富多样,下面列举几个常见的技术:
前端技术:HTML、CSS、JavaScript是最基本的前端技术,它们用于网页的结构、样式和交互功能的开发。还有更专业的前端框架和库,如React、Angular、Vue等,能够加速开发效率和提升用户体验。
后端技术:后端技术主要用于处理与服务器交互、数据存储和安全等方面的问题。常见的后端技术包括Java、Python、PHP和Node.js等编程语言,以及数据库技术如MySQL、MongoDB等。
移动应用开发:新媒体网络编程也与移动应用开发息息相关。移动应用开发技术包括iOS开发(Objective-C或Swift)、Android开发(Java或Kotlin)等。

3. 新媒体网络编程的未来发展趋势是什么?
随着计算机和互联网技术的不断发展,新媒体网络编程也将迎来更多的发展机遇和挑战。以下是一些可能的未来发展趋势:
首先,移动化和智能化将成为新媒体网络编程的重要方向。随着智能手机的普及和移动应用的快速发展,移动设备将成为人们获取和分享信息的主要工具。新媒体网络编程需要不断优化和适应移动设备的特性,提供更好的用户体验和交互方式。
其次,用户个性化需求的增加将推动新媒体网络编程的发展。用户对信息的个性化定制需求越来越高,未来的新媒体网络编程需要通过数据分析和机器学习等技术,提供更准确和有针对性的信息推送。
最后,安全和隐私保护将成为新媒体网络编程的重要议题。随着网络黑客和信息泄漏的风险增加,新媒体网络编程需要加强数据安全和隐私保护的技术和措施,确保用户信息的安全性和可靠性。

总之,新媒体网络编程通过计算机和互联网技术的应用,使得信息传播更加便捷和快速,为用户提供更多的交流和互动机会。它涉及的技术丰富多样,未来发展的趋势也将越来越向移动化、个性化和安全化方向发展。

文章标题:新媒体网络编程是什么意思,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1656201

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词不及物动词
上一篇 2024年4月28日
下一篇 2024年4月28日

相关推荐

  • 编程用什么系统好

    编程用什么系统好? 在选择编程使用的操作系统时,1、Linux 2、Windows 3、MacOS是最常见的选择。其中,Linux因其开源性、灵活性和强大的社区支持,被许多开发者推崇。Linux系统提供了丰富的编程工具和语言支持,使得开发者可以根据自己的需要自定义环境,这在其他操作系统中是难以比拟的…

    2024年4月25日
    6100
  • 法兰克编程是什么编程语言

    法兰克编程,即Frank编程语言,在设计理念上拥有两大核心,1、综合类型系统、2、效果系统。其中,综合类型系统特别地,它使得开发者可以在一个统一的框架内处理不同类型的数据与操作,这样的设计可以极大地增强代码的可复用性和可维护性。 一、综合类型系统 综合类型系统是Frank编程语言中的一个核心特点。它…

    2024年5月1日
    4200
  • asp是什么编程技术

    Active Server Pages (ASP) 是一种服务器端脚本环境,它允许开发人员创建动态交互式网页应用程序。它利用服务器端脚本来创建内容响应,可以与数据库连接,并返回客户端浏览器的HTML页面。ASP 是一个简单易用、可在多种数据库系统上进行数据驱动的技术,通过其内置对象,可以实现复杂的交…

    2024年5月12日
    000
  • 编程新手应该做什么

    编程新手应该做了解编程基础、选择一门编程语言、实践编程项目、学习算法与数据结构、参与社区交流和编写文档。对于了解编程基础而言,新手首先需要建立起对于编程的基础认知,比如理解程序是如何运行的,软件开发的生命周期,以及基本的编程概念。这一阶段,可以从阅读入门书籍、在线课程或教程开始,包括但不限于变量、控…

    2024年5月12日
    000
  • 校园oa系统

    校园OA系统的关键优势体现在如下几点:提高办公效率、促进信息共享、加强数据安全、支持移动办公1、扩展系统功能性2。这些优势共同促进了教育机构管理的现代化和信息化。特别是在系统功能性扩展方面,校园OA系统可以结合教学实际,针对不同学院、科系的特定需要定制模块,如在线作业、成绩管理及远程教育资源,进而增…

    2024年1月12日
    57000
  • 木工CNC编程用什么软件

    木工CNC编程常用的软件有AutoCAD、Cabinet Vision、SketchList 3D、Fusion 360、ArtCAM、AlphaCAM、和Mastercam。这些软件各有特点和优势。例如,AutoCAD 是行业内广泛应用的一个工具,它提供了强大的2D绘图和3D建模功能,能够帮助工程…

    2024年5月12日
    000
  • 写编程选什么配置硬盘

    编程选择硬盘配置时,关键因素包括1、存储空间大小、2、读写速度、3、耐用性和可靠性。尤其是读写速度,在进行大量数据处理或复杂程序编译时尤为关键。较高的读写速度能显著提高编程效率,减少等待时间。因此,选择固态硬盘(SSD)而不是机械硬盘(HDD)通常是更好的选择,尽管SSD的成本相对较高。SSD提供了…

    2024年5月12日
    300
  • 东江oa系统

    标题:探究东江OA系统的功能与实施效益 摘要:东江OA系统为企业提供数字化办公环境、效率提升、数据安全和流程管理优化四大核心能力。具备提升工作效率1、强化企业行政管理2、保障信息数据安全3、以及促进沟通协同4、等功能特点。对于保障信息数据安全这一点,系统运用先进的数据加密技术与权限控制机制,确保了敏…

    2024年1月12日
    21400
  • 为什么编程运行不了

    程序运行不成功通常可以归因于几个核心原因:1、代码错误、2、环境配置不当、3、依赖问题、4、系统兼容性问题。其中,代码错误是最常见的原因之一,它包括语法错误、逻辑错误以及运行时错误。详细来说,语法错误通常由打字错误、遗漏关键字或者使用了错误的符号引起;逻辑错误意味着代码的结构或流程有问题,导致程序不…

    2024年5月9日
    1300
  • 什么是ic编程

    IC(集成电路)编程是一种将预定的程序或数据传输到集成电路中的过程。其中一点非常关键的是,对安全性的需求,尤其是在财务和个人数据处理的IC卡应用中。此类编程确保了应用程序的正确运行,并在一定程度上保障了数据的完整性与安全性。 一、IC编程的基本概念 IC编程,又称之为集成电路编程,涉及到的是将代码或…

    2024年5月2日
    4700

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部